Output 662136911dfd939ff9b0d09a43d195762d05f9e766523e3d4849150bbd1bf26e:5

value
25714995
script pubkey
OP_0 OP_PUSHBYTES_20 57536da483aab2e75bdb1f3df45c76b0c2953fa7
address
bc1q2afkmfyr42ewwk7mru7lghrkkrpf20a8ut7kcm
transaction
662136911dfd939ff9b0d09a43d195762d05f9e766523e3d4849150bbd1bf26e
spent
true